#7bc15d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7bc15d is composed of 48.2% red, 75.7% green and 36.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 36.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 51.8% yellow and 24.3% black. It has a hue angle of 102 degrees, a saturation of 44.6% and a lightness of 56.1%. #7bc15d color hex could be obtained by blending #f6ffba with #008300.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

Shades and Tints of #7bc15d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050803 is the darkest color, while #fafdf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#7bc15d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8c9688 is the less saturated color, while #63fd21 is the most saturated one.
